Lay summary
Our project aims to identify the health needs and priorities of the Ngāi Tai iwi community in Auckland, New Zealand. We will use a combination of interviews, surveys, and focus groups to collect information on health and wellbeing from members of the community. We will also examine existing data and research on health disparities and outcomes in the Ngāi Tai population. Our goal is to develop recommendations for addressing health inequities and improving the overall health and wellbeing of the community. As part of this project, we will also explore the feasibility of establishing a Ngāi Tai health hub to provide culturally appropriate health services and resources. The outcomes of this project will inform future health initiatives for the Ngāi Tai iwi and contribute to the broader efforts to address health disparities and promote health equity in New Zealand.
